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0613785921 19 6711 108645
13731372 20938929315
13731372 20938929315
4038885497 3779020 23244
All about undefined
Interested in learning more?
13731372 20938929315
4038885497 3779020 23244
See more
8646127 68403099 2533815431
71882 883450 71152093379
See more
12047 74721669 44921081170
42 3846095 72385291 699
See more